Buying Guide: How To Choose The Right Packable Camera Insert

What size fits your kit? Measure your bag’s interior length, width, and height, then compare to each insert’s dimensions. If you carry multiple bodies and several lenses, prioritize inserts with adjustable dividers and a rigid frame to prevent collapsing.

How important is weather protection? Look for water-resistant exteriors or waterproof liners for gear exposed to rain or splashes. If you shoot in varied environments, a bag with a sealed liner helps keep dust and moisture out.

Do you need quick access vs. maximum protection? Magnetic flaps or open-top designs provide fast access, while padded, multi-layer layouts prioritize protection and organization. Consider your typical workflow when choosing.

Portability and weight matter. Lightweight, foldable inserts save space in carry-on bags, while heavier-duty frames offer steadier protection for larger lenses. If you travel often, a foldable design can save space during transit.

Compatibility with existing gear. Ensure the insert’s dividers can accommodate your camera bodies, lenses, flashes, and accessories without forcing gear into awkward shapes. DIY divider options help customize arrangement.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• What is a camera bag insert? — It’s a padded liner with dividers placed inside a larger bag to organize and protect camera gear.
  • Are these inserts compatible with all bag brands? — Most inserts are designed to be universal, but it’s essential to check interior dimensions against your bag.
  • Should I buy a large or small insert? — Choose based on your typical kit size. Larger inserts accommodate more gear but take more space; smaller inserts are lighter and more portable.
  • Do inserts protect against moisture? — Some have water-resistant exteriors or liners; for rain-prone shoots, consider additional weather protection for the bag.
  • Can I customize the dividers? — Many inserts include adjustable or removable dividers to tailor fit for different lenses and bodies.
  • Is a backcountry or travel-ready insert better? — For frequent travel, opt for foldable, lightweight designs that compress when not in use.
